    The new auction house is amazing!

    It's insane how much better the AH is now. You just buy the item you want, at ANY amount you want, and it's always the cheapest price. No more buying out all these weird stack amounts when you just want X amount.

    Same thing with selling. It's just two clicks now. No more needing to look up how much the item is going for and manually typing in the price.

    It's fantastic. I can't believe we've been using that awful original AH for so long.

    For buying its awesome, and the mail with stacking stuff from the AH.

    For sellers it's a pretty siginficant downgrade, practically speaking. Takes quit a lot longer time to get stuff out. One example is crafted stuff with different stats. It's not hard by any means just takes longer time to check stuff. Which is my grief with it all.

    But overall, it's a decent upgrade. The one stack penalty seems to be gone on most trade materials, and it's faster to search for stuff with huge quantities. Remember searching for some herbs throught 50 pages on the AH? Cya in 30 minutes.
